Transaction 15d4f6964a538b00bc7f8d81baaeb7254b61f00c6943d1c292f95ccc226326fe
1 Input
1 Output
-
15d4f6964a538b00bc7f8d81baaeb7254b61f00c6943d1c292f95ccc226326fe:0
- value
- 3301727
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a98a94f9d2882cca63739b6db2a8370079ca101
- address
- bc1q32v2jnua9zpvef3h8xmdk25rwqreeggp6fw48m